Anti Wrinkle Cotton Chef Jacket Sourcing Guide
Sourcing anti-wrinkle cotton chef jackets requires balancing professional aesthetics with rigorous functional demands. Buyers must prioritize garments that maintain a crisp appearance throughout long shifts while providing comfort and durability. The core keyword highlights a specific intersection of material science and occupational design, where cotton offers breathability and polyester or synthetic blends provide structural integrity. This combination is essential for kitchen environments where heat, moisture, and frequent laundering are constant factors. Understanding these material dynamics helps procurement teams select products that reduce replacement frequency and enhance staff morale through consistent, professional presentation.
The procurement process involves navigating a diverse supplier landscape, particularly from manufacturing hubs like Jiangxi, China, where many OEM and ODM providers operate. Buyers should verify that suppliers offer customization options, including logo placement via print, embroidery, or heat-transfer methods, to align with brand identity. Additionally, confirming the availability of various sizes, from small to 3XL, ensures inclusivity for diverse staff body types. The focus should remain on verifying that the "anti-wrinkle" claim is backed by specific fabric treatments or blends, rather than relying on generic marketing terms, to ensure the product meets the high standards of hotel and commercial kitchen operations.

Material composition is a critical signal, with many suppliers listing cotton/polyester blends, twill, CVC, or TC fabrics. Some listings specify a fabric weight of 180 GSM, which is a reasonable benchmark for durability without excessive bulk. The inclusion of features like rip-stop, quick-dry, and anti-static properties indicates a focus on safety and efficiency in busy kitchens. Buyers must distinguish between products labeled as "chef scrub" versus "chef jacket," as the latter often implies a more formal, double-breasted design suitable for front-of-house or high-end culinary presentations. Verifying the exact material breakdown is essential, as pure cotton may wrinkle more easily than blended options, directly impacting the "anti-wrinkle" performance claim.
Technical Specifications to Verify
Technical verification begins with confirming the fabric composition and weight, as these directly influence the anti-wrinkle performance and longevity of the jacket. Buyers should request detailed fabric specifications, ensuring that the cotton content is balanced with synthetic fibers like polyester or spandex to enhance shape retention. The listed fabric weights, such as 180 GSM, should be validated against the intended use case; heavier fabrics offer durability but may reduce breathability. Additionally, verifying the dyeing method, whether plain dyed or solid color, ensures colorfastness through repeated industrial laundering. Suppliers should provide data on shrinkage rates and color retention to guarantee that the jackets maintain their professional appearance over time.

Compliance and Safety Documentation
Compliance and safety documentation are paramount for chef jackets, especially those marketed with features like flame retardancy or anti-static properties. Buyers must request test reports from accredited laboratories to verify that these claims are substantiated. For instance, if a jacket is labeled as flame retardant, it should meet relevant international safety standards for protective clothing. Similarly, anti-static properties should be validated through conductivity tests to prevent static buildup in dry kitchen environments. These documents are essential for risk management and ensuring that the uniforms do not pose a hazard to staff or compromise kitchen safety protocols. Without verified test data, buyers risk non-compliance with local occupational health and safety regulations.
Additionally, buyers should ensure that the materials used are compliant with food safety and hygiene standards. While the jackets themselves may not come into direct contact with food, they are worn in food preparation areas, making fabric cleanliness and chemical safety important. Suppliers should provide declarations of conformity for any chemical treatments applied to achieve anti-wrinkle or quick-dry effects. This includes verifying that no harmful substances are present in the dyes or finishes. Cost Drivers and Commercial Terms
Cost drivers for anti-wrinkle cotton chef jackets include material quality, customization complexity, and order volume. Higher cotton content or specialized blends like CVC and twill typically increase the base cost, while additional features such as rip-stop or flame retardancy add to the price. Customization options, including logo placement via embroidery or heat-transfer, also contribute to higher unit costs. Buyers should analyze the trade-off between price and durability; cheaper options may require more frequent replacement, increasing long-term expenses. Understanding these variables helps in budgeting accurately and negotiating better terms with suppliers based on projected order volumes and specific feature requirements.

Supplier Qualification and Quality Control
Supplier qualification is a critical step in ensuring the reliability and quality of anti-wrinkle cotton chef jackets. Buyers should assess suppliers based on their experience in OEM and ODM services, as well as their ability to provide consistent quality across large orders. Verifying the supplier's production capabilities, including their factory size and equipment, helps gauge their capacity to meet demand. Additionally, checking for any relevant certifications or quality management systems, such as ISO standards, can provide assurance of their commitment to quality. Buyers should also review the supplier's track record, including client testimonials and case studies, to evaluate their reliability and professionalism in the industry.
Quality control measures should be established before production begins to prevent defects and ensure consistency. Buyers should define clear quality standards, including fabric weight, stitching quality, and color accuracy, and communicate these to the supplier. Implementing pre-production samples and in-line inspections can help identify and rectify issues early in the manufacturing process. Final random inspections before shipment are essential to ensure that the delivered goods meet the agreed-upon specifications. Buyers should also establish a clear process for handling defects or discrepancies, including return policies and compensation terms. By rigorously qualifying suppliers and implementing robust quality control measures, buyers can minimize risks and ensure a smooth procurement experience.
